Transaction 071ea06b74a7ff46eae8d99231697d2af16887b48b4b21df28d02ffb1908adcf

block
e276939c61fc6799ef1d73591e9da065e09f87b5b572a99bfa030b09ce11d60e

60 Inputs

2 Outputs